The Mt Herman Trail, which can be found on https://www.alltrails.com/trail/us/colorado/mount-herman-trail, is a bspectacular 2.2 mile hike out and back, with a 900 ft elevation gain. The trail is a beautiful backwoods experience, and the peak overlooks Colorado Springs from 9,232 feet. The hike is mostly easy, with moderate difficulty toward the top. Boots, sunglasses, windbreakers and hats will be needed, and you should plan on bringing water and snacks in a day pack. It is advised to bring poles and/or microspikes if you have them, to avoid slippage on descent from the top.
